
Port Huron Extends Unbeaten Streak To Nine Games With Victory

PORT HURON, MI - The Port Huron Icehawks defeated the Bloomington PrairieThunder 2-1 on Saturday in front of 2,599 fans at McMorran Arena. The win was the Icehawks second consecutive victory over the PrairieThunder and their 11th triumph in 12 contests with Bloomington this season. They also defeated their rival 3-2 at McMorran Arena on Friday.
The Icehawks soar to a three game winning streak and a nine game unbeaten streak. They also extend their home point streak to eight games. With a record of 34-16-5-1 and 74 points, Port Huron holds on to first place in the International Hockey League standings with a two point lead over the second place Muskegon Lumberjacks. Fifth place Bloomington dips to 23-28-1-3 with 50 points.
The first goal of the contest came off the stick of Derek Patrosso at 12:42 in the second period. The marker was the rookie's 16th of the season and extended his goal streak to three games. Derek Merlini and Tab Lardner were credited with assists. Lardner then extended the Icehawks lead to 2-0 when he scored on a pass from Kris Vernarsky at 7:43 in the third period.
Bloomington finally got on the board at 17:18 in the third frame when Mike Kusy scored his first professional goal to spoil the Icehawks bid for their sixth shutout of the season.
The Icehawks outshot the PrairieThunder 28-24. Icehawks goalie Larry Sterling made 23 saves on 24 shots to earn the win. Bloomington's Jason Wolfe turned aside 26 of 28 shots. Both teams were scoreless on the power play despite three opportunities.
The Icehawks play four games next week as they continue their run toward the Turner Cup Playoffs. They visit Kalamazoo on Wednesday, host the same Bloomington PrairieThunder on Friday, travel to Muskegon on Saturday and face a rematch with Kalamazoo at home on Sunday.
